Aimed Force 08693 a i rant util mine sweeping copters arrive in Indian Ocean by the associated pits the first Elm anti of a unil of mine sweeping Heli copters arrived at the Indian Ocean Island of Diego Garcia monday for use in the persian Gulf he Pema gon announced tuesday. Meanwhile the re flagged 46,732-ton kuwaiti Tanker Gas Prince with a Load of liquefied Petroleum Pas destined for Japan left its . Navy escort behind tuesday and sailed into the Oman Gulf after passing through the Strait of Hormuz on monday. A Pentagon source said the eight mine sweeping Heli copters that arrived on Diego Garcia will be transferred to the amphibious helicopter Carrier Guadalcanal. Pentagon sources also said the amphibious Landing ship Raleigh was dispatched Over the weekend from Norfolk va., to Charleston s.c., where it was being loaded with several Small Navy mine sweeping boats. The sources would not say when it would sail for the Gulf. Shipping sources in Kuwait said the mine-damaged401.382-ton Brit Goclon would leave in a week to 10 Days with a partial Load of Oil possibly making the southbound trip with a Convoy scheduled to begin the 500-mile voyage up the Gulf thursday the Gas Prince originally had been scheduled to make the return voyage with the Bridgton but the supertanker was unable to take on a Load of Oil quickly because of the damage from the mine. The decision was made to go ahead and gel the Gas Prince out of there said one source. The Bridgeton was t ready and we saw a Chance to move the Gas Prince out of there quietly the two Are the first of 11 kuwaiti vessels being re registered in the United states so the . Navy can protect them. Kuwait also has chartered tankers Hying the soviet and British flags. Trie iranians accuse Kuwait of receiving arms ship ments for Iraq the emirate s Eastern neighbor at the head of the Gulf and have made regular attacks since september on ships owned by or serving Kuwait. Iron Contra hearings close after 11 weeks of testimony Washington not the scheduled Public hearings on the Iran Contra affair ended with the chair men of the congressional investigative committees calling the 11 weeks of testimony chilling and de having listened to about 250 hours of testimony from 28 Public witnesses the panels will hear later this week from four Central intelligence Agency officials in closed session then take a recess through labor Day before reconvening in september to prepare a report of their findings and recommendations. The Story has now been told the Senate commit tee s chairman Daniel Inouye said in his closing statement monday. I see it As a chilling Story a Story of deceit and duplicity and the arrogant disregard of the Rule of the House panel s chairman. Rep. Lee Hamilton d-ind., said that he had found the hearings de pressing but that he believed they were an essential part of the self cleansing process of our system of gov the final witness. Defense Secretary Caspar Wein Berger added Little on monday to his testimony Las Friday when he documented his vigorous opposition to the Iran arms sales and told How others in the administration had deceived him. He did however take Issue with the statement of Robert Mcfarian the former National Security adviser that the United states did not have sufficient intelligence information to undertake a Mission to Rescue hostages. Weinberger did not elaborate saying he could not discuss the matter in Public. Inouye a Hawaii seemed especially disturbed by the assertions of Nonh and Poindexter that survival in a dangerous world sometimes required measures beyond the Bounds of the Normal processes of govern ment. That said Inouye is an excuse for autocracy not for policy. Vigilance abroad does not require us to abandon our ideals or the Rule of Law Al Home.
